ECG’s Code of Ethics and Business Conduct provides a uniform understanding as to what is expected of our employees and embodies our commitment to excellent counsel and service to all stakeholders. The code is supplemented by our Day-to-Day Situation Guide, which addresses issues specific to our industry.
We’re also committed to maintaining high ethical standards externally by the third parties that we engage. As a result, we developed a Code of Ethics for Suppliers and Service Providers to ensure that subcontractors, freelancers, suppliers and other third parties understand and agree to comply with our expected standards in all business dealings related to Evolution Communcations Group.
Evolution Communications Group is committed to focusing online behavior through the lens of “doing the right thing.” We have a Digital Code of Conduct that is updated annually, as our online behavior policies closely mirror the dramatic pace of change that has occurred across the digital world. Our guidelines have been constructed to reflect the evolving norms of online community behavior, especially as it pertains to how corporations, and the agencies acting on their behalf, comport themselves online.
In July 2013, Evolution Communications Group published a framework of ethical ideals related to sponsored content in the U.S. news media.
In future field research ECG will examine the diverse approaches, opportunities and challenges that exist across other key geographies.
